    Kevin Durant to win Finals MVP +180

    I've said all along this is Durant's moment. He's playing out of his mind. We all knew he'd get crazy good looks in this offense and that's exactly what's happened. Those jump shots are just a little bit cleaner looks and he was already a great shooter to begin with. When they swing the ball around the defense gets out of sorts and he's able to easily drive to the basket.

    The Cavs don't want to put LeBron on him. It's simply too taxing given what they need from him on offense. They'll match up in spots but not likely for prolonged stretches. That leaves guys like J.R. Smith, Richard Jefferson, Iman Shumpert, etc to guard KD. Yea that's not gonna cut it. Those guys have no chance.

    The Cavs need pretty much a miracle to beat this juggernaut 4 times. The MVP likely comes down to Durant or Curry but KD is more capable of putting up the gaudy numbers. Good chance he averages around 30 and 8 on great shooting percentages. That should get it done.
